Nutrient Density Scoring System Explained
In the ever-evolving landscape of **nutrition and health**, understanding the concept of **nutrient density** has become crucial for making informed dietary choices. The **nutrient density scoring system** is an innovative framework designed to help individuals evaluate the nutritional quality of foods and prioritize those that provide the most nutrients per calorie. This system empowers consumers to make healthier choices by focusing on foods that offer essential vitamins, minerals, and other beneficial compounds, while minimizing unnecessary calorie intake. As individuals become increasingly aware of the impact of their dietary habits on overall health and well-being, **nutrient density scoring** has gained traction as a valuable tool in the pursuit of optimal nutrition.
The origin of **nutrient density scoring** can be traced back to the growing need to address the prevalence of **nutrient deficiencies** and **obesity-related diseases**. With the modern diet often laden with calorie-dense but nutrient-poor options, there is a critical need to emphasize foods that provide maximum nutritional value. **Nutrient-dense foods**, such as **fruits**, **vegetables**, **lean proteins**, and **whole grains**, are rich in essential nutrients required for optimal health, including vitamins, minerals, fiber, and phytonutrients, while being relatively low in calories. By prioritizing these foods, individuals can enhance their nutrient intake without exceeding their daily caloric needs, thus supporting weight management and reducing the risk of chronic diseases.
**Nutrient density scoring systems** assign a numerical value to foods based on their nutrient content relative to their caloric value. This allows consumers to easily compare food options and make choices that align with their health goals. Such systems often consider a wide range of nutrients, including protein, fiber, vitamins C and A, calcium, iron, and potassium, among others. Foods with higher scores are considered more nutrient-dense, providing greater health benefits per calorie consumed. The scoring system not only guides individuals toward healthier eating patterns but also serves as an educational tool, promoting a better understanding of the complex relationship between food consumption, nutrient intake, and health outcomes.

Several studies have highlighted the importance and effectiveness of **nutrient density scoring systems** in promoting healthy eating habits. A notable study published in the Journal of the Academy of Nutrition and Dietetics examined the correlation between nutrient density scores and health outcomes, concluding that higher scores were associated with improved dietary quality and a reduced risk of chronic diseases such as cardiovascular disease, diabetes, and certain cancers. The study underscored the utility of nutrient density scores as a practical strategy for individuals seeking to enhance their diet quality while managing caloric intake.
In another research effort, conducted by the **Nutritional Epidemiology Branch** of the National Cancer Institute, researchers developed a scoring system known as the **Nutrient Rich Foods Index**. This index rates the nutrient density of foods based on their content of key nutrients in relation to their energy content. Findings from the study demonstrated that individuals who predominantly consumed higher-scoring foods had a lower body mass index, maintained healthier blood pressure levels, and experienced a lower incidence of metabolic syndrome. These results provide compelling evidence of the positive impact that **nutrient density scoring systems** can have on overall health and nutritional status.
The application of **nutrient density scoring** extends beyond individual health, influencing public health policies and dietary guidelines. For example, the Dietary Guidelines for Americans incorporate the concept of nutrient density as a cornerstone for developing recommendations that encourage the consumption of nutrient-rich foods. By informing policy development and shaping dietary standards, nutrient density scoring systems have the potential to address public health challenges by guiding populations toward healthier eating patterns that can help prevent nutrition-related diseases.
